#f17f42 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f17f42 is composed of 94.5% red, 49.8%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.3% magenta, 72.6%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 20.9 degrees, a saturation of 86.2% and a lightness of 60.2%. #f17f42 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ffe84 with #e30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#f17f42 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f17f42 has RGB values of R:241, G:127,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.47, Y:0.73,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15826754.

Shades and Tints of #f17f42
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0501 is the darkest color, while #fffb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f17f42
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9998 is the less saturated color, while #f97d3a is the most saturated one.
